Transaction d111bc21d5a413b40bf826d62d20f31af16f09bb9e9b4ba73b523680062eea73
1 Input
2 Outputs
- d111bc21d5a413b40bf826d62d20f31af16f09bb9e9b4ba73b523680062eea73:0
- d111bc21d5a413b40bf826d62d20f31af16f09bb9e9b4ba73b523680062eea73:1
value 104406217
address 1ArFD5v2T18yQXyk1vY5EEtwzKtsL46UuE
value 24023340873
address 1H8SY9HfBNajZimSkVuZL8AfUJuVYi9JRi